Beekeeper Registration Form

If you keep bees in New York City, you must register them with the NYC Department of Health. All hives must be re-registered annually by May 31. If you have any questions or concerns about this form or the requirements, please send an email to beekeeping@health.nyc.gov.
 
You will need to provide the block and lot number in this registration. You can find your block and lot online at NYC Building Information System
 
Complete and submit a separate form for each hive. If you have additional hives in different locations, please complete and submit one form for each hive (hive location).
